2007 Chrysler 300 vs. 2003 Mazda Tribute

To start off, 2007 Chrysler 300 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2003 Mazda Tribute.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2003 Mazda Tribute would be higher. At 2,967 cc (6 cylinders), 2003 Mazda Tribute is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Mazda Tribute (194 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 5 more horse power than 2007 Chrysler 300. (189 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2003 Mazda Tribute should accelerate faster than 2007 Chrysler 300.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Chrysler 300 weights approximately 225 kg more than 2003 Mazda Tribute.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Chrysler 300 (259 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 28 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Mazda Tribute. (231 Nm @ 4750 RPM). This means 2007 Chrysler 300 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Mazda Tribute.

Compare all specifications:

2007 Chrysler 300 2003 Mazda Tribute
Make Chrysler Mazda
Model 300 Tribute
Year Released 2007 2003
Body Type Sedan S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2701 cc 2967 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 189 HP 194 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 259 Nm 231 Nm
Torque RPM 4000 RPM 4750 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Top Speed 204 km/hour 174 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 11.1 seconds 11.8 seconds
Drive Type 4WD 4WD
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1815 kg 1590 kg
Vehicle Length 5010 mm 4400 mm
Vehicle Width 1890 mm 1810 mm
Vehicle Height 1490 mm 1720 mm
Wheelbase Size 3050 mm 2270 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 9.8 L/100km 12.8 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 68 L 61 L
